I have several toolbars open in PPT 2003. I arrange them the way I
want them, but they keep moving. Is there some way to lock the
arrangement?

It depends on what the tool bar is for.

The PowerPoint ones should remain as you left them. Some add-ins recreate
the tool bar each time they run, (for example, my xx of yy add-in does this)
so they do not remember where you moved them because they are deleted each
time you close PowerPoint. This was poor coding/planning on my part back
when I wrote that one. What I do is keep that particular add-in loaded, but
not active until I need it. This way it does not show until I ask it to and
it does not keep popping up in the way whenever I start PowerPoint.

Which toolbar is it that fails to stay moved?
